Some (well all except sqlite) database platforms support timezone configuration. The problem is that we expect everything in UTC, but some servers might have set some different default (e.g. in database configuration or even just because of `TZ` environment variable). This causes incorrect values when expecting `NOW()` to return the current time in UTC. For PHP we already enforce UTC as timezone, this PR adds a middleware that enforces UTC also as the database connection / session timezone. Signed-off-by: Ferdinand Thiessen <opensource@fthiessen.de>
